gow3.jpg In May of this year, we posted an article that said that Amazon.com has God of War III listed with a March 2009 release date. Problem is that a bit of information may have been leaking in the form of a listing on the internet movie database (IMDB) website. Since the announcement of God of War III, no official mention has yet been made of when games can expect to actually be playing it. A slip on IMDB may however, have more of answer for us than Sony does. On the page of Terence (T.C) Carson, the voice actor for Kratos, a new project has been added. Yup, you guessed it, God of War III. Now as is always standard practice on IMDB, the year of the game, TV show or movie title is always put in brackets next to the project. According to the information on IMDB, the title is set for 2010 and is "in production". If the information is correct then it looks like we may have to wait for more than a year to be able to go on Kratos's next adventure. The only thing we can hope for is that the game could be set for a March/April release but we all know that publishers like to aim for the Christmas season and if that is true, the wait for God of War III could possibly still be another 2 years from now. That is a very, very long time.

Halo3.jpg Just yesterday, we posted a head to head between Gears of War 2 and Halo 3 from IGN that asked the question of which one of the two huge Xbox 360 exclusives was the absolute must-have for the system. For anyone who missed it and doesn't feel like going back to watch the video, Halo 3 won. Many will argue that Gears of War 2 is the better game but the latest statistics from Xbox Live are saying quite the opposite. While the full list is posted after the jump, let me lay things out for you. Firstly, this list shows what people have been playing while connected to Live, not how many people were playing the games multiplayer modes on Xbox Live so make a note of that. The results, especially after this recent gaming season, are astounding. Ok , so here is the list: Halo 3 Gear of War 2 CoD: World at War GTA IV Fable II Left 4 Dead Madden NFL 09 Fallout 3 FIFA 09 Now here is the amazing thing, even though we have just been through arguably the best gaming release season of all time, the hugely popular multiplayer modes found in both Gears of War 2 and even Call of Duty: World at War could not take the number 1 spot from the (already over a year old) phenomenon that is Halo 3. That means that even though there was a large number of people playing Call of Duty and Gears of War's single player campaign as well as multiplayer modes (including the incredibly addictive Gears of War 2 semi co-op experience, Horde), Halo 3 still took the top spot with what can now only be people who are still playing the multiplayer. While South Africans never really caught on to Halo 3 like the Americans did, we have to appreciate that Bungie must have done something very right to still have the top spot over all this time. Call of Duty 4 is sitting just below Call of Duty: World at War, meaning that while there are still a lot of players who prefer last years offering, World at War is still making quite an impact on the world, regardless of the fact that Treyarch were at the helm. Just seeing this is almost making me want to go back and play some more Halo 3 multiplayer just to try and see if I can see what all the fuss is about. Honorable mentions come in with Left 4 Dead which is proving to be a massively fun multiplayer experience as well as GTA IV considering it's age and even Fallout 3 considering that it doesn't have any multiplayer. I want to make a mention of Fable II as well although I think that if it's co-op multiplayer had been better, it might have made more of an impact.

If you, like me were one of the people that forked out a bunch of Microsoft Points to get your hands on the beat-em-up title Castle Crashers on Xbox Live, only to find out that the best part (online co-op) was plagued with connectivity and lag issues, then this is a bit of good news. There was no doubt that the biggest reason for anyone connected to Xbox Live to get the game was to experience the great arcade action that the game had to offer together with some friends. We all downloaded the game, started playing and were then hit with a ton of issues. This lead me to the decision to pretty much leave the game alone until a patch came out to fix it so that I could properly enjoy the experience that I had been looking forward to for so long. Problem is, that the patch has now taken over 3 months to arrive, so where is it and why are we all waiting so long? The guys at Xbox360Fanboy seem to feel the same way and so they got ahold of Behemoth to try and get some sort of answer with regards to the progress of the patch. Behemoth were happy to respond and have said the following: "We're working with Microsoft to get the title update out as quickly as we can. Sadly, we can't get into details about the certification process, but we've resolved the game's issues with data loss and networking in addition to other bugs. We can't really comment on the release yet as we're not allowed to talk about it because of Microsoft, but the update's release is definitely reaching the end of the process. We've received great support from our fans on our forums in identifying issues. That feedback has helped out a lot and we're really honored to have such an awesome group of fans in the community." Hopefully this means that the patch will be available in not too long (If we are lucky it will be before everyone goes on holiday) and we can all finally kick some ass online with our buddies.
